>Brothers,
>        I was taking a good look through the Convention Amendments today
>and i was struck by the BYOB/ Risk management policy that is proposed.
>This stipulates that BYOB be standard policy for all chapter events. It
>seemed simple enpugh until I read the definitions at the bottom.
>        According to the definition,  a chapter event is defined as any
>activity where a majority of the active brotherhood is present. Am I to
>understand that if I decide to have a party and more than half of the
>actives show up, that my party is then a "chapter function" and I am required
>to abide by all of the red tape included in the restrictions and procedures?
>As it is worded in the packet, that is what it seems to say (read it for
>yourselves). I would appreciate it if somebody can clarify this.
>

Chris and other interested:

        I have not seen the proposed admentments, but it seems to me that
Chris' interpetation of the proposal is incorrect.  If by having x number of
brothers present constitutes a "Chapter Function", then would it be a
function of your University if you were to throw a party and half of the
student body showed up?  Even if it's not possible to have half of your
school at a party, think of a similar analogy.
        You would only have to abide by the Risk Management Policy only if
the function were sponsored (paid for) by the chapter.  Check with your RD
for their intrepretation, but that is how  I would read it.
